        This guy wrestling in college at least?

        Brock had a wrestling background so him going into MMA made sense. CM only did pro wrasslin so its not THAT surprising he had different results.

        Anyone with a legit amateur wrestling background at very least gots a foundation to build something on. How viable things are from that foundation to a successful career is a whole other variable that'll be decided based on your age, how hard you are willing to work, how much time you are willing to put into it & your ability to learn.
